Advertisement
Guest User

Untitled

a guest
Feb 21st, 2019
135
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.86 KB | None | 0 0
  1. session.checkip(req.ip, function(result) {
  2. console.log(result);
  3. });
  4. exports.checkip = function(ip, callback) {
  5. var r = false;
  6. let connection = mysql.createConnection({
  7. host: 'localhost',
  8. user: 'root',
  9. password: 'Escola171995',
  10. database: 'website_personal_trainer'
  11. });
  12.  
  13. connection.connect(function(err) {
  14. if (err) {
  15. return console.error('error: ' + err.message);
  16. }
  17.  
  18. console.log('Connected to the MySQL server. checkip');
  19. });
  20.  
  21. connection.query('select * from session', function(err, result, fields){
  22. for (var i in result)
  23. if (result[i].ip == ip) {
  24. r = true;
  25. break;
  26. }
  27. connection.end(function(err) {
  28. if (err) {
  29. return console.log('error:' + err.message);
  30. }
  31. console.log('Close the database connection.');
  32. callback(r);
  33. });
  34. });
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ement